WebMay 15, 2015 · DON’T apply pressure to the globe. DON’T let patients squeeze their eyes shut. External pressure to the globe can influence the measurement. This can occur from the patient squeezing his or her eyes or the examiner inadvertently applying pressure to the globe. Many patients need assistance adequately opening their eye during tonometry. WebGlaucoma is a chronic, progressive eye disease caused by damage to the optic nerve, which leads to visual field loss. One of the major risk factors is eye pressure. An abnormality in the eye’s drainage system can cause fluid to build up, leading to excessive pressure that causes damage to the optic nerve.
